You know when the label on the cigarettes packet says, for example:
"10mg Tar
0.9mg Nicotine
10mg Carbon
Monoxide"

Is that per cigarette or gram? or...?
 
It's supposed to be per cigarette.

However, those are the numbers that you get when you burn the whole cigarette, and not what the smoker actually takes in, even if they keep the cigarette in their lips constantly. So, it's a maximum. Also, when one breathes the smoke out, much of the tar, nicotine and the other 999 substances that come from burning tobacco goes out as well.
